Location and Reviews
The St. Lucia Tet Paul Nature Trail Tour is located in Castries, St Lucia.
Based on 5 reviews across Viator and Tripadvisor, the tour has an impressive rating of 4.6 out of 5. Priced from £116.79 per person, the tour accommodates up to 30 travelers.
This guided nature walk offers scenic views of the southern region, including Martinique on clear days.
Travelers can also observe traditional fishing methods in Anse La Raye and explore the local farming community in Chateau Belair, all while enjoying the stunning vistas of the Piston peaks and Jalousie Bay.

Meeting and Pickup
To ensure a seamless experience, the tour pickup can be arranged from any hotel in Saint Lucia.
The tour operator offers flexible pickup options, catering to late-arriving ships.
Travelers will easily spot the "JAMES TOURS" sign held up by the driver, making the meeting point clearly visible.
The tour starts promptly at 9:00 am, allowing participants to make the most of the day’s activities.
